I have been tasting hundreds of wine samples from California's Central Coast, and I have been incredibly impressed with all the wines made from Rhone Valley grape varieties. I have been particularly blown away with some of the whites. Check out this video and find out which 2009 Paso Robles Roussanne is my favorite so far. (Excuse my pronounciation of Rous-Ann! I was too excited about the wine!)

2009 Copain Roussanne Paso Robles: This is bright and beautiful with dried pears and apples and peaches. Full and fresh with an intense almost apple sauce sort of flavor. Long finish. Very true to the grape. From Saxum vineyards. Drink now. 94 points.
